    DRC Wins Technology, Management and Evaluation Services Contract Supporting NIH

    Dynamics Research Corporation (DRC) today announced that it’s been awarded with a new task order under the Chief Information Officer—Solutions and Partners 3 (CIO-SP3) contract to provide technology, management, and evaluation services to the National Institutes of Health (NIH). The contract has a value of $11.4 million and has a five-year period of performance.

    “The rigorous evaluation of enterprise IT systems and processes is critical for enabling agencies like the NIH to maximize their technology investments and uncover new ways to strategically leverage technology for improved mission outcomes,” said Jim Regan, chairman and CEO of DRC. “With this task order, our first task order under the CIO-SP3 contract, we will extend our technology expertise, management consulting insight and healthcare domain experience in support of this new customer.”

    Under the terms of the contract, DRC will provide independent verification and validation expertise to support the NIH IT enterprise system project managers in their efforts to maximize their IT investments. The technical services provided will include assisting the NIH enterprise system and projects in risk management and promoting use of best-in-breed technical approaches.
